Energy Efficiency

Wood stoves are getting more energy efficient. Modern models are rated between 70 and 80%, meaning that they convert a substantial amount of the energy generated by the fire into heat. This drastically reduces fuel costs, making them a more environmentally friendly alternative to fossil fuels.

Burning wood is also considered carbon neutral because it doesn't increase carbon dioxide levels in the air. Additionally it is possible to harvest wood sustainably, using only the trees that are needed and thereby preventing other trees from being cut down unnecessarily. The majority of modern wood stoves are able to reuse the exhaust gases to further reduce emissions. This is also known as secondary combustion. However, some older non-catalytic models do not include this feature and permit unburned gases to escape the chimney.

These unburnt gasses may cause the accumulation of creosote within the chimney, which can cause health risks. This is particularly true for those with respiratory diseases like asthma, chronic obstructive lung disease, and Emphysema. Long-term exposure to smoking wood can also lead to pulmonary fibrous disease.

On the other hand, selecting a wood stove with secondary combustion will greatly reduce the harmful consequences. This is due to the catalytic combustor used in these stoves permits combustion to occur at lower temperatures, allowing the exhaust gases to be burned more efficiently and thoroughly.

It is best 5kw Wood burning stove to search for EPA certification when buying a wood stove that has secondary combustion. This will ensure that the stove is built to meet minimum clearance standards, thereby preventing it from posing any fire risk to your home.

It is also important to be aware of keeping the combustibles to a minimum of 12-18 inches away from the wood-burning stove. In addition, the wall should be insulated to further stop fires from spreading.

Reduced Power Outages

Wood burning stoves are not dependent on electricity. They are a great tool in the event of an outage in power, since they are able to provide heating and cooking even if other electrical appliances don't work. This is especially true during the winter months, when temperatures drop and power is often limited.
